SOURCE: Saeco Odea Giro - disassembly

Hope this can help:

I managed to take mine apart because I was having a lot of leaking steam from the steam wand (as posted earlier). I followed your instructions, and all worked very well. Just to prepare readers, this is what I found. The green seal on the steam end was torn, as previously described. I noticed it start to "drag" a bit during use (daily for the past year), and it must have stuck and torn over time. See photos. I replaced with a part from ACE, see photo. Be sure to lube before re-assembly. Hope the photos help!

Hi i have a Saeco Odea Giro Plus, that was broken ceramic baked klay. after replace new it have a problem with my Saeco Odea Giro. The problem is that the bean grinder doesnt grind (I only hear sound of...

Hi,
you need to change this part ,which is under the ceramic knife. You will have to open the coffee grinder and take out the knives and change the holder to the lower knife. That's your problem. This is the product code 149198350

Hi i have a grinder problem with my Saeco Odea Go

Try this remove all the beans using a vac cleaner, then turn to lowest-finest number, then remove screws on grinder lift chamber and turn knob to coarsest setting and reassemble and try machine, remember to adjust grind when machine is grinding.
